Overview

Give four AI engineers their own supercomputer instead of four sets of cloud credits. Four DGX Spark units supplied, imaged and supported as one deployment: 512 GB of unified memory in total, each seat independently running models up to roughly the 200B class, all on-premises and all under your control.

Key highlights

  • 4× NVIDIA DGX Spark — one per developer, each a complete AI system.
  • 512 GB unified memory in total (128 GB per seat), ~200B-parameter class per unit.
  • 16 TB NVMe across the pod for datasets and checkpoints.
  • Deployed as one project: common image, common tooling, single support contract.
  • Any two units can be linked over ConnectX-7 for ~405B-class work when needed.
  • Four desks, four wall sockets — no rack, no server room, no facility spend.
  • Replaces contended cloud GPU credits with fixed, predictable INR capital cost.

AI workload positioning

⚠️ Read this honestly: this is four independent machines, not one 512 GB memory domain. The unified-memory figure is the pod total, and a single model cannot span all four units. What it buys is parallel human productivity — four engineers each working uninterrupted on their own hardware — which for most teams is the real bottleneck, not peak throughput. If you need one large shared model, buy a GPU server instead and we will tell you so.

On-prem vs cloud (TCO)

For sustained daily AI work this configuration removes per-GPU-hour billing, queueing for scarce instances, and egress charges on your own data — and keeps everything on-premises for DPDP and data-residency obligations. Cloud still wins for burst capacity and one-off very large training runs; on-prem wins on sustained utilisation, control and predictable INR capital cost. We model the crossover with your actual usage rather than assert it.

Software & day-one readiness

Each unit ships with NVIDIA DGX OS and the full NVIDIA AI stack — CUDA, cuDNN, containers, and the common serving and fine-tuning frameworks (vLLM, PyTorch, NGC catalogue). It is the same CUDA environment as every larger NVIDIA system RDP supplies, which is why work developed here moves upward to a GPU server or rack-scale system without a rewrite.
